Daswi - Manawar, Dhar

Daswi is a village situated in the Manawar tehsil of Dhar district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 16 km from the tehsil headquarters in Manawar and around 91 km from the district headquarters in Dhar. Daswi village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Daswi is 475632. The village covers a total geographical area of 657.93 hectares and falls under the 454446 pincode. Manawar is the nearest town, located about 16 km away.

Daswi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Daswi

As per Census 2011, Daswi village has a total population of 1,350 people, consisting of 649 males and 701 females. The village has 278 households and a sex ratio of 1,080 females per 1,000 males. There are 210 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 604 literate and 746 illiterate residents. Additionally, 44 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 748 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Daswi

Daswi is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Mhow, while the nearest airport is Devi Ahilyabai Holkar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 81.2 km.

The road distance from Manawar to Daswi is about 16 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Dhar to Daswi is about 91 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
